My Fitbit Alta switches off the moment its charging plug is removed. I have tried restarting it by pressing the micro switch three times within 8 seconds, however after rebooting also the problem persists. Moreover, the display works when it is plugged on and shows the battery as fully charged, However moments after removing the charging plug, it goes dead and no amount of taping is able to bring it to life. This problem started exactly a year after flawless performance. Please help
